JHANGORA KI KHEER (JHANGORA PUDDING)

Jhangora is the Indian name for millet, a grain rarely used in the United States. A speciality of Uttaranchal, it is typically served as a dessert.

Number Of Ingredients 7

2 cups millet (jhangora)
3/4 cup sugar
2 quarts milk
1/2 tablespoon cashew nuts
1/2 tablespoon raisins
1/4 cup almonds
2 tablespoons kewra essence or 2 tablespoons rose water, to taste

Steps:

  • Boil milk in a thick bottom pan.
  • Add jhangora in it and then cook well. Stir to avoid lumps.
  • Add sugar and cook for some more time till the sugar is fully dissolved.
  • Next add of kewra essence to give it a sweet flavour. Mix this essence well.
  • Garnish with chopped dry fruits. Serve cold with fruit salsa on the side.
